Ingredients

  • 4 slices of whole grain or sourdough bread
  • 1 cup fresh spinach, washed and dried
  • 1 cup feta cheese, crumbled
  • 2 tablespoons butter, softened
  • ¼ teaspoon garlic powder (optional)
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Step-by-Step Instructions

Creating a Feta Grilled Cheese Sandwich with Spinach is a straightforward process. Follow these simple steps to achieve perfection:

  1. Prepare the Bread: Start by laying out the slices of bread on a clean surface.
  1. Spread Butter: Evenly spread a thin layer of softened butter on one side of each slice. For added flavor, sprinkle a little garlic powder on top of the butter.
  1. Add Feta: On the unbuttered side of two slices, place a generous amount of crumbled feta cheese.
  1. Layer Spinach: Next, distribute the fresh spinach evenly over the feta cheese, sprinkling a little salt and pepper to taste.
  1. Top with More Cheese: If you like, add a little more feta on top of the spinach for extra cheesiness.
  1. Close the Sandwich: Place the remaining slices of bread on top, buttered side facing out.
  1. Preheat Skillet: Heat a skillet over medium heat. Once preheated, carefully place the sandwiches in the skillet.
  1. Cook the Sandwiches: Grill the sandwiches for about 3-5 minutes on one side until crispy and golden brown.
  1. Flip and Finish Cooking: Gently flip the sandwiches, applying pressure with a spatula. Cook for an additional 3-5 minutes, until the other side is golden and the cheese is gooey.
  1. Serve Hot: Once perfectly golden, remove from the skillet and cut in half. Serve immediately for the best taste.

Additional Tips

  • Balance the Flavors: Adjust the amount of feta cheese based on your preference. For a milder taste, use less feta and add more spinach.
  • Use Fresh Spinach: Fresh spinach works best for flavor and texture. Avoid using frozen spinach, as it tends to be watery.
  • Experiment with Cheese: Feel free to mix feta with other cheeses like mozzarella or cheddar for a richer flavor profile.
  • Grill to Perfection: Ensure your skillet is at the right temperature. Too hot may burn the bread, while too low may not melt the cheese properly.
  • Add Herbs: Fresh herbs like dill or basil can enhance the flavors. Sprinkle them on the spinach before grilling for an extra flavor kick.

Freezing and Storage

  • Storage: Store the sandwiches in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at on a skillet for best results.
  • Freezing: You can freeze assembled sandwiches before cooking. Wrap tightly in plastic wrap and freeze for up to 2 months. Thaw overnight in the fridge before cooking.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use different types of bread?

Yes! Sourdough, whole grain, or even gluten-free bread make great alternatives.

Can this sandwich be made vegan?

Yes, substitute feta with a vegan cheese option and use plant-based butter.

What if I don't have garlic powder?

Feel free to use fresh garlic or omit it altogether. The sandwich will still be delicious!

Can I make it in a panini press?

Absolutely! A panini press will give you an even crispier finish while warming the cheese perfectly.

Is this sandwich good for meal prep?

Yes, you can prepare the ingredients in advance and assemble before cooking.
